Job Description:

Our school is a renowned institution dedicated to providing a world-class education that fosters creativity, critical thinking, and digital literacy. We offer a supportive and stimulating learning environment, equipped with state-of-the-art facilities, including dedicated media studios and technology labs. Our Media Studies department is committed to fostering a love of media and preparing students for the challenges and opportunities of the 21st century.

The Role

  • Deliver Engaging Lessons: Design, plan, and deliver inspiring Media Studies lessons across the curriculum, catering to diverse learning styles and ensuring all students can develop their media skills effectively.
  • Develop Media Skills: Foster students' understanding of media theory, production techniques, and critical analysis.
  • Prepare for Success: Prepare students for success in relevant Media Studies qualifications, such as GCSE and A-Level, by providing rigorous academic instruction and guidance.
  • Encourage Creativity and Innovation: Promote creativity and innovation in media production, empowering students to develop their own original ideas and projects.
  • Contribute to the Department: Collaborate with colleagues to create a positive and inclusive learning environment and contribute to the overall success of the Media Studies department.

The Ideal Candidate

  • Qualified Media Studies Teacher: With a passion for the subject and a proven track record of success in teaching Media Studies.
  • Strong Subject Knowledge: Demonstrated expertise in media theory, production techniques, and critical analysis.
  • Excellent Classroom Management: Effective classroom management skills to maintain a positive and productive learning environment.
  • Inspirational Leader: Ability to inspire and motivate students of all abilities, fostering a love of media and encouraging their creativity.
  • Tech-Savvy: Experience in using media production equipment and software, such as cameras, editing software, and audio recording equipment.
  • Collaborative Team Player: Willingness to work effectively with colleagues to achieve shared goals and create a positive and supportive learning environment.

What We Offer

  • Competitive Salary and Benefits: A competitive Inner London salary and comprehensive benefits package.
  • Professional Development: Opportunities for professional growth and advancement, including training and mentoring programs.
  • Supportive Environment: A collaborative and supportive working environment where your contributions will be valued and recognized.
